Tutorial VSFTPD Skip to main content

Tutorial VSFTPD





 Kalian udah tau belum apa itu VSftpd? nah berikut adalah tutorialnya gan...



1. Pertama atur IP terlebih dahulu, dengan perintah ‘nano /etc/network/interfaces’.

2. Isikan IP nya terserah kalian.


3. Setelah mengatur IP saatnya merestart, dengan perintah ‘/etc/init.d/networking restart’.


4. Setelah merestart, saatnya menginstall VSFTPD, dengan perintah ‘apt-get install vsftpd’.


5. Lalu ketikan perintah ‘cd /’.


6. Lalu atur IP pada client windowsnya, gatewaynya merupakan IP server VSFTPD.


7. Lalu setelah mengatur IP coba lakukan PING ke IP server.


8. Setelah itu coba masuk ke FTP di windows explorer, karena prinsip VSFTPD itu anonymous jadi tanpa kita memasukan username dan password langsung bisa mengakses FTP nya.


9. Coba kita buat supaya VSFTPD saat mengakses FTP meminta untuk memasukan username dan password, pertama ketikan perintah ‘nano /etc/vsftpd.conf’.


10. Lalu cari tulisan anonymous_enable=YES


11. Lalu ubah anonymous_enable=YES menjadi NO, dan tanda # di depan tulisan local_enable dan write_enable dihapus, sehingga seperti berikut ini.


12. Setelah mengedit, lakukan restart, dengan perintah ‘/etc/init.d/vsftpd restart’.

 13. Setelah itu buat sebuah user untuk log on ke ftp nantinya. Dengan perintah ‘adduser (namauser)’.


14. Setelah itu di client pada windows explorernya ketikan ’ftp://ipserver’ dan akan muncul kotak yang akan meminta untuk memasukan username dan password untuk log on ke ftp, jadi disini sudah tidak anonymous lagi melainkan sudah menggunakan user untuk log on ke ftpnya.


15. Lalu masukan username dan password yang tadi sudah kita buat di server.


16. Lalu setelah kita masukan username dan password kita akan masuk ke ftp seperti berikut ini, yang artinya vsftpd yang default prinsipnya menggunakan anonymous untuk mengakses sekarang sudah menggunakan user untuk log on kedalamnya.


17. Lalu sekarang kita akan membuat hak dari sebuah user untuk log on, jadi tidak semua user dapat log on ke ftp, hanya user yang didaftarkan yang bisa mengakses ftp. Pertama ketikan perintah ‘nano /etc/vsftpd.conf’.


18. Lalu cari tulisan chroot_local_user dan chroot_list_enable seperti berikut ini.


19. Lalu hapus tanda # sebelum tulisan chroot_local_user dan chroot_list_enable menjadi seperti berikut ini.


20. Setelah mengedit, lakukan restart, dengan perintah ‘/etc/init.d/vsftpd restart’. 

21. Setelah itu ketikan perintah ‘dir /home/’. Yang fungsinya untuk melihat keseluruhan user yang ada.


22. Lalu akan terlihat beberapa user yang ada, yang dapat mengakses ftp.


23. Lalu saatnya untuk mendaftarkan user yang boleh log on ke ftp. Ketikan perintah ‘nano /etc/vsftpd.chroot_list’.


24. Setelah itu akan muncul kotak kosong, lalu tuliskan user yang nantinya diperbolehkan untuk log on ke ftp.


25. Setelah mendaftarkan sebuah user untuk log on ke ftp, saatnya restart dengan perintah ‘/etc/init.d/vsftpd restart’.


26. Lalu coba masuk dengan user yang tidak didaftarkan. Apakah bisa?


27. Setelah kita menekan enter akan keredirect untuk memasukan username dan password yang benar atau dengan kata lain kita harus memasukan username dan password yang telah didaftarkan oleh server untuk mengakses.



28. Setelah itu coba kita masuk dengan user yang tadi didaftarkan oleh server.


29. Ternyata hak untuk mengakses ftp yang kita telah buat berhasil, disini dengan user yang telah didaftarkan oleh server kita sudah dapat log on ke ftp.


30. Sekarang saatnya kita meremote ftp menggunakan CMD pada client, ketikan perintah
‘ftp (ipserver)’.


31. Lalu akan diminta untuk memasukan username dan password, masukan lalu enter.
32. Setelah kita memasukan username dan password, akan terlihat tulisan login successful yang artinya kita sudah berhasil masuk untuk meremote ftp menggunakan CMD.



33. Sekarang kita coba untuk membuat direktori di ftp menggunakan CMD, ketikan perintah ‘mkdir (namadirektori)’.
 

35. Lalu akan terlihat direktori yang tadi kita buat di CMD.

                                           









 36. Lalu coba buat sebuah file yang nantinya akan digunakan untuk diupload ke ftp.

37. Sekarang ketikan perintah ’put’. Yang fungsinya untuk mengupload sebuah file ke ftp.
38. Setelah kita menekan enter, masukan local file atau tempat file yang tadi kita buat
39. Lalu setelah kita menekan enter, akan muncul tulisan remote file, langsung saja di enter.
40. Lalu akan terlihat tulisan successful yang artinya file yang kita upload sudah berhasil terupload.


.

41. Lalu coba log on ke ftp dengan user yang tadi log in menggunakan CMD.


42. Lalu akan terlihat file yang kita upload sudah berhasil dan sekarang ada di ftp.


43. Lalu sekarang coba untuk menghapus sebuah file dari ftp menggunakan remote dari CMD, ketikan perintah ‘delete’.
44. Lalu akan muncul tulisan remote file, yang artinya file apa florist di bekasi  yang ingin dihapus dari ftp.





45. Lalu akan muncul tulisan successful yang artinya file yang ada di ftp sudah terhapus.


46. Lalu coba log on ke ftp lagi dengan user yang tadi log in menggunakan CMD untuk memastikan.
47. Dan ternyata file yang kita hapus menggunakan remote CMD sudah tidak ada atau dengan kata lain kita sudah berhasil menghapus file dari ftp menggunakan CMD.





Comments

Banyak dibaca

Analisis spesifikasi server(windows server 2008) dan client (windows7)

  Analisis spesifikasi server(windows server 2008) dan client (windows7)   Tujuan 1. Mengetahui sejarah windows server 2008 2. Mengetahui tentang kelebihan dan kekurangan pada Windows Server 2008. 3. Mengetahui spesifikasi minimum hardware dan software windows server 2008. 4. Memahami jenis jenis windows server 2008. 5. Mengetahui spesifikasi 32 dan 64 bit pada windows 7 Konsep dasar Windows Server 2008 Windows Server 2008 adalah sebuah versi baru Windows Server, yang dirilis pada tanggal 27 Februari 2008. Pada saat pengembangannya, Windows Server memiliki nama kode “Windows Server Codenamed Longhorn.” Windows Server 2008 dibangun di atas beberapa keunggulan teknologi dan keamanan yang pada awalnya diperkenalkan dengan Windows Vista, dan ditujukan agar bisa lebih modular secara signifikan, ketimbang pendahulunya, Windows Server 2003 . Windows Server 2008 dikembangkan dari Windows Server 2003 R2 yang sudah terbukti cukup andal dan aman, untuk membantu

4 Percetakan Printing Terbaik di Kota Bekasi Dengan Kualitas Cetak Terbaik

Dalam dunia kerja atau dunia kuliah tentunya banyak orang yang membutuhkan jasa percetakan untuk tugasnya ataupun untuk dokumen penting sebagai laporan pertanggungjawaban kepada atasan jika anda merupakan salah satu orang yang belum mengetahui didaerah mana letak percetakan terbaik di bekasi, tidak ada salahnya anda meluangkan waktu untuk membaca informasi 7 percetakan printing terbaik di bekasi. 4 Percetakan Printing Terbaik di Kota Bekasi Dengan Kualitas Print Terbaik, Cocok Untuk Anak Kuliah Desain 1. Digital Printing Bekasi Banyak nya kompetitor tidak membuat digital printing yang sudah berdiri sejak 10 tahun lebih ini patah semangat untuk memberikan inovasi baru dari tahun ke tahun, kelebihan dari toko ini yaitu memiliki tenaga kerja yang cukup dan berpengalaman, sehingga hasil print dan waktu pengerjaan menjadi lebih cepat. Digital Printing Bekasi adalah salah satu toko printing yang bisa dipercaya kualitasnya Informasi  Alamat    : Herjaya Print & Signage,

Pengertian IP Address dan Penjelasannya

Pengertian IP  addres Internet Protocol Address  atau sering disingkat  IP ) adalah deretan angka biner antar 32-bit sampai 128-bit yang dipakai sebagai alamat identifikasi untuk tiap komputer host dalam jaringan  Internet . Panjang dari angka ini adalah  32-bit  (untuk  IPv4  atau IP versi 4), dan 128-bit (untuk  IPv6  atau IP versi 6) yang menunjukkan alamat dari  komputer  tersebut pada jaringan Internet berbasis  TCP/IP Cara mengonversi angka yang biasa terdapat pada IP Address menjadi bilangan biner dengan manual sekaligus menghihitung ip broadcast dan IP Network pada suatu IP address yang diketahui, akan saya paparkan di sini: Cara mengonversi Bilangan bulat ke dalam Bil. Biner Sebelumnya apakah anda sudah benar benar mengerti tentang apa itu bilangan biner, jika belum saya akan jelaskan terlebih dahulu. Bilangan biner adalah bilangan yang hanya terdiri dari angka 0 dan 1, bilangan ini merupakan dasar dari semua sistem bilangan berbasis digital. Sistem ini juga dapat